Tide Launches Omnichannel, On-Demand Laundry Service

PYMNTS

Tide, the laundry brand owned by CPG Detergent, is introducing a service called Tide Cleaners, an on-demand dry cleaning and laundry service, at 1,000 locations in cities across the country, according to reports. There are currently boxes in Dallas, Boston, Cincinnati, Nashville, Denver, Washington D.C.

10 Big Bank Marketing Lessons from the ABA Bank Marketing Conference

South State Correspondent

Last week, the American Banking Association (ABA) held its annual Bank Marketing Conference in Denver, receiving rave reviews. Most banks will target around 6% of revenues next year for their marketing budget, and banks with strong brands and marketing programs target above 7%. The theme was – developing your marketing superpowers.
